Modeling stress-induced responses: plasticity in continuous state space and gradual clonal evolution

Summary

This study introduces a new mathematical framework to model how cancer and bacteria evolve resistance through both genetic mutations and phenotypic plasticity. This approach helps understand population responses to stress and informs therapeutic strategies.
